Preliminary Discussion on the Structure of a Novel Housefly Pupae Lectin

Abstract  In order to provide plenty of information about the relationship between its structure and function, the structure of a novel housefly pupae D-galactose binding lectin with the molecular weight 55kDa and immune acitivity was analyzed preliminarily. In the first place, oligosaccharide chain was confirmed to be existed in this kind of novel housefly pupae lectin by the method of gel staining, and then its structure was analyzed with the help of protein sequencing instrument, spectrophotometer color contrast, β- elimination reaction, infrared spectroscopy and atomic force microscopy. This kind lectin was a globalshaped monomer with the diameter 75 nm or so and the protein and oligosaccharide content 97.36% and 2.1% respectively. Peptide chain and oligosaccharide chain was linked by O-glycoside bond with the N-terminal blocked and the sugar ring alpinum type. All above was the reliable theory for further analysis of structure.
